NouZetwals – meaning “Our Stars” in Mauritian Creole – is a bold, independent non-profit initiative dedicated to transforming the health and social care landscape in Mauritius. Just as stars light the night sky, our care professionals illuminate the lives of others every day. It’s time their brilliance was recognised.

Health and Social Care Excellence Summit and Awards

At the heart of our work is the Health and Social Care Excellence Summit & Awards, a landmark national celebration of those who shine brightest in service to others — across public and private sectors, clinical and non-clinical roles, in Mauritius and the diaspora.

On 25 April 2026, the inaugural ceremony will launch a new tradition: a night where care’s unsung heroes step into the spotlight, celebrated as the guiding lights of our nation.

Award Categories

Student of the Year

Celebrating students in health, social care, or associated disciplines.

Rising Star

Honouring early-career professionals who show exceptional promise for the future.

Clinical Care Excellence

Celebrating individuals who are making a remarkable impact on service users.

Non-Clinical Excellence

Spotlight on non-clinical and behind-the-scenes staff who are essential to high-quality care.

Team Excellence

Highlighting multidisciplinary teamwork, integration, and improvements in service delivery.

Educator / Training Initiative of the Year

Individuals or organisations that excel in teaching, mentoring, or developing staff and students.

Innovation & Research

Celebrating innovative approaches, research, or projects improving knowledge, practice, and outcomes.

Quality & Safety Award

Recognising commitment to quality, safety, and risk management, and improving care delivery.

Staff Wellbeing & Leadership

Honouring inspirational leaders or initiatives that promote staff wellbeing, resilience, and morale.

Fairness, Equity, Diversity & Inclusion Champion

Individuals or teams advancing inclusive practices ensuring underrepresented groups are valued and supported.

Community Care & Outreach

Projects or initiatives that bring together community partners and improve integrated services.

Lifetime Achievement

Celebrating an individual whose career-long contribution has significantly shaped a lasting legacy inspiring others.

Patient Choice

Honouring professionals whose care and dedication have made a profound, personal impact on those they serve.
